The quark can be made savoury for a nice spread or dip or sweet for a desert. It’s a type of cream cheese that can vary in taste between slightly sour and sweet, which mainly depends on its fat content. Quark is common in the Netherlands, in German-speaking regions, in Scandinavia, and parts of Eastern Europe. The longer you drain, the drier the quark. The quarks texture dependis on how long you drain it.
